Developing Good Social Skills

Practicing active listening is an important social skill that can help us to build strong relationships with others. This involves truly paying attention and being present in the conversation, instead of just waiting for our turn to speak. 

It also includes asking questions and restating what we heard to ensure clarity. Furthermore, actively listening allows us to gain better understanding of a person’s point-of-view which encourages empathy and respect.

Being open to constructive feedback from friends or colleagues is another way of improving our social skillset. This means learning how to accept criticism without becoming defensive or taking it personally. Instead, we should focus on using this feedback as an opportunity for growth and improvement by identifying areas where we can make changes based on the advice given.

Finally, showing respect for others is essential when developing healthy relationships with people around us. Respectful behavior involves treating everyone equally regardless of their age, gender, beliefs or opinions; communicating in a polite manner; avoiding making assumptions about someone’s background; and offering support whenever possible without trying to solve the problem ourselves if not asked directly for help. By practicing these simple steps regularly we can enhance our interpersonal connections while building trust within those relationships at the same time

Working Through Issues

When it comes to working through issues with friends or colleagues, effective communication is key. It’s important to be open and honest about how we are feeling without accusing the other person of what went wrong. This means being clear in our words while remaining respectful throughout the conversation. Additionally, by focusing on solutions rather than blame we can come up with a positive outcome that both parties can agree on.

It’s also helpful to stay mindful of our nonverbal cues when discussing difficult topics so as not to make anyone feel uncomfortable or defensive. For instance, maintaining eye contact during conversations helps build trust and understanding between people while providing assurance that everyone involved is being heard and respected at the same time. Furthermore, controlling body language such as avoiding crossed arms or closed-off stances conveys openness which encourages others to communicate more freely as well

In addition, having a mediator present during complex conversations might be beneficial in order for all parties involved to remain calm and focused. A third party can help keep the discussion organized while allowing each individual an opportunity speak their truth without judgement from either side; this ultimately helps resolve any conflicts quickly and effectively without causing further tension between those affected by it.

Finally, making sure that everyone feels safe within these hard discussions is essential for successful conflict resolution; this includes allowing space for expression without fear of retaliation no matter how tense things become among those involved in the issue at hand
